独塔单索面预应力斜拉桥爆破拆除  被引量:6

Blasting Demolition of Prestressed Cable-Stayed Bridge with Single Tower and Single Cable Plane

出  处:《爆破》2020年第4期89-93,137,共6页Blasting

摘  要:针对在市区复杂环境下爆破拆除独塔单索面预应力斜拉桥,采用桥面原地坍塌爆破技术与主塔定向控制爆破技术相结合的手段成功爆破拆除金婺大桥。重点介绍大桥主塔、主墩和梁块的爆破参数、起爆网路以及安全防护措施。通过主塔钻孔预切割、桥面机械破除的预处理方式,采用孔内、孔外相结合的延时起爆技术,并采取立体防护措施和混合缓冲垫层,使大桥解体充分,取得了良好的爆破效果。爆破飞石、冲击波和爆破振动均在安全允许范围内,未对周围建(构)筑物造成损害。Jinwu Bridge a prestressed cable-stayed bridge with single tower and single cable plane in urban complex environment.It was successfully demolished by the vertical collapsing and directional controlled blasting technologies on the bridge deck and main tower respectively.This research introduced the blasting parameters,detonation network and safety protection measures of the main tower,main pier and bridge beam.The research adopted pretreatment methods of drilling and precutting of the main tower and mechanical destruction of the bridge deck.Then,a delayed detonation technology combining the in-hole delays and out-hole delays was adopted.Meanwhile,a three-dimensional protection measure and a mixed cushion were implemented.The bridge was fully disintegrated and a good blasting effect was achieved.Flying rocks,shock waves and blasting vibrations were all within the allowable range of criterions,and there were no damage to the surrounding buildings(structures).

关 键 词:独塔单索面预应力斜拉桥 控制爆破 原地坍塌 预处理 混合缓冲垫层
